Introduces Resource-recycled Multifunction Digital Printers, ApeosPort-VI C5571 R and C3371 R
SINGAPORE, Sept. 14, 2023 /PRNewswire/ -- FUJIFILM Business Innovation Asia Pacific launches two remanufactured*1 A3 colour digital multifunction printers, ApeosPort-VI C5571 R and C3371 R from the ApeosPort-VI C series. The printers were developed based on the principle of treating used products as valuable resources instead of as waste. Sales will commence from 15 September in the Asia Pacific region*2.
In a circular economy, it is paramount to maintain the quality and consistency of materials used in recycled products. FUJIFILM Business Innovation is committed to sustainable development and has been bolstering its environmental strategy with various initiatives, such as collecting used products from users to adopt a closed-loop system. The remanufactured printer series reduce environmental impact with their parts reuse rate of 84% (by weight), and CO2 emissions reduced to 56% as compared to newly manufactured printers*3 throughout their product lifecycles.
Main features of ApeosPort-VI C5571 R / C3371 R
[Closed-loop system]
FUJIFILM Business Innovation established a company-wide recycling policy in 1995 and a circular production system examining the entire product lifecycle, from product planning, development, and manufacturing stages to disposal was introduced in the same year. Aiming to achieve infinite "zero landfill", used products are collected, parts are selected, and reused through applying recycling technologies.
FUJIFILM Business Innovation will contribute towards a decarbonized society through innovative technologies, products, and services, and to attain the ultimate goal of Fujifilm Group's Sustainable Value Plan 2030 with a reduction of CO2 emissions across the entire product life cycle by 50% by fiscal 2030 and to achieve a net zero CO2 emissions by fiscal 2040.
*1: Remanufactured product is made by used products which are collected from users. The product is disassembled and cleaned. Parts that do not meet a certain quality standard are replaced. |
*2: Please check with your local FUJIFILM Business Innovation office on the availability of the devices. |
*3: When comparing ApeosPort-VI C4471 RC and ApeosPort VI C4471. |
